How to access a Beeline Wi-Fi router: complete instructions for all models

Logging into your Beeline router's control panel is the first step to setting up Wi-Fi, changing your password, or troubleshooting internet issues. Even if you've never worked with network equipment before, the authorization process will take no more than 5 minutes with the right approach. The key is knowing the device's exact IP address, the default login credentials, and understanding what to do if the router isn't responding.

Equipment manufacturers for Beeline (including ZTE, Huawei, Sercomm And Sagemcom) use different combinations of addresses and credentials. In this article, we'll cover the universal login methods applicable to 90% of models, as well as the nuances for specific devices. If your router returns an error ERR_CONNECTION_REFUSED or the login page won't open—here you'll find proven solutions.

1. Preparing for entry: what you need to know before you begin

Before attempting to access settings, please ensure three key conditions are met:

  • 🔌 The router is plugged in and the power indicator is on. green (or blue, depending on the model). If the light is blinking orange, the device is still booting up.
  • 📶 Your device (PC, laptop, smartphone) is connected to the router via cable (recommended) or via Wi-Fi. For a wireless connection, use the network name indicated on the router sticker (usually Beeline_XXXX).
  • 🌐 VPNs, proxies, and ad-blocking extensions (such as AdBlock) are disabled in your browser—they may interfere with the control panel's loading.

If you are connecting via Wi-Fi but don’t know the password, find it on the router sticker (field Wi-Fi Key or Password). Most Beeline models have a standard password - an 8-digit code consisting of numbers and Latin letters, for example A1B2C3D4If the sticker is worn off or missing, you'll need to reset the settings (more on that in section 6).

2. Standard IP addresses and login details for Beeline routers

Each router model has a unique IP address To access the web interface, the following combinations are most commonly used on Beeline equipment:

Manufacturer Model IP address Login Password
ZTE H298N, H298A, H368N 192.168.1.1 admin admin or beeline
Huawei HG8245H, HG8247H 192.168.100.1 telecomadmin admintelecom
Sercomm H500-s, RV6699 192.168.0.1 user user or beeline
Sagemcom Fast 5364, 5655 192.168.1.1 admin Last 8 characters SSID (from the sticker)

Important: Huawei routers for Beeline often require you to enter your login and password two windows - first for access to the WAN port (data above), then for local settings (usually admin/admin). If the standard combinations don't work, check the sticker on the back of your device - it may contain unique information.

⚠️ Note: Manufacturers periodically update firmware, which may change the default login credentials. If none of the combinations work, try resetting the router to factory settings (button) Reset for 10 seconds).

3. Step-by-step instructions: how to access your router settings

Follow this algorithm to open the control panel:

  1. Open your browser (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, Safari, or Edge). Avoid browsers with aggressive script blocking (e.g., Brave in strict mode).
  2. Enter the IP address in the address bar (without http:// or www). For example: 192.168.1.1.
  3. Press EnterIf the address is correct, an authorization window will appear. If the page doesn't load, check your router connection or try a different IP address from the table above.
  4. Enter your login and password (See Section 2). If the information is correct, you will see the main settings page.

If an error appears after entering data 404 Not Found or the page "loads endlessly", the reasons may be the following:

  • 🔄 The router is overloaded - turn it off for 30 seconds and turn it on again.
  • 📡 Incorrect IP address - check your device model and refer to the table.
  • 🔒 Antivirus blocking - temporarily disable network protection in your antivirus settings.
  • 🛠️ Damaged firmware - requires reflashing or replacing the device.

4. Login features for popular Beeline models

Some routers have unique authentication nuances. Let's take a closer look at them:

ZTE H298N / H298A

These models often come with two Wi-Fi networks: main (2.4 GHz) and guest (5 GHz). To enter settings:

  1. Connect to the network Beeline_XXXX (2.4 GHz).
  2. Enter in your browser 192.168.1.1.
  3. Use login admin, password - beeline (if it doesn't fit, try admin).

Huawei HG8245H

This router has two levels of access:

  • 🔐 User Mode (limited settings): login user, password user.
  • 🔧 Admin Mode (full access): login telecomadmin, password admintelecom.

If you see the inscription "Insufficient privileges", then you have entered User Mode - log out and log in again with administrator rights.

Sercomm H500-s

This model has non-standard access port — 8080 is used instead of 80. Try entering:

192.168.0.1:8080

If the page does not open, check if your firewall is blocking ports.

⚠️ Attention: On routers Sercomm After three unsuccessful login attempts, your account will be locked for 5 minutes. If you've forgotten your password, reset it immediately.

5. What to do if the router doesn't open the login page

If after all these manipulations the control panel still does not load, use these methods:

🔄 Factory reset

Press and hold the button Reset (usually located on the rear panel) during 10-15 secondsuntil the indicators start flashing. After reset:

  • 🔄 The router will reboot (this will take 1–2 minutes).
  • 📋 All settings will be reset, including the Wi-Fi password.
  • 🔑 Your login details will become default (see section 2).

🖥️ Checking network settings on your PC

Sometimes the problem lies in incorrect network settings on your device. To reset them:

  1. On Windows: Open Control Panel → Network and Internet → Network and Sharing Center → Change adapter settings.
  2. Right click on the connection Ethernet (or Wi-Fi), select Properties.
  3. Find Internet Protocol version 4 (TCP/IPv4), click Properties and check the boxes Obtain an IP address automatically And Obtain DNS server address automatically.

📡 Alternative connection methods

If the web interface is not available, try:

  • 📱 Beeline Dom mobile app (available for Android and iOS). Compatible with most modern models.
  • 🖥️ Telnet/SSH (for experienced users). For example, using the command:
    telnet 192.168.1.1

    The login and password are the same as for the web interface.

How to enable Telnet on Windows 10/11?

Open Control Panel → Programs and Features → Turn Windows features on or offFind . Telnet client and check the box. Then click OK and wait for the installation.

6. Common mistakes and their solutions

Let's look at typical problems and how to solve them:

Error Cause Solution
ERR_CONNECTION_TIMED_OUT The router is not responding to requests Check the physical connection, reboot the router, try a different cable
401 Unauthorized Incorrect login/password Reset the settings or check the data on the sticker
The page is "loading forever" IP conflict or script blocking Clear your browser cache, disable ad blocking, or try a different browser.
This site can’t be reached Incorrect IP address Check your router model and use the correct IP from the table.

If the router displays a message "The page cannot be displayed" If the IP address is correct, the web server may be disabled in the settings. In this case, only a reset or a firmware update will help. TFTP-server (for experienced users).

7. Security: How to protect your router after logging in

After successful authorization, it is recommended to take several steps to protect your device:

  • 🔐 Change the default password complex (at least 12 characters, with numbers and special characters). For example: Beeline_2026!Router.
  • 📡 Disable remote control (option Remote Management (in the settings). This will prevent access to the router from the internet.
  • 🛡️ Update the firmware (chapter System Tools → Firmware Upgrade). Outdated versions are vulnerable to hacker attacks.
  • 📋 Create a backup copy of your settings (option Backup Configuration). Useful in case of failures.

If your router supports guest network, set it up with a separate password and speed limit. This will protect the main network from unauthorized access.

⚠️ Warning: Never leave your router with factory security settings. Default passwords (admin/admin) are known to hackers and can be found in a few minutes.

FAQ: Answers to Frequently Asked Questions

🔍 How do I find out the model of my Beeline router?

The model number is indicated on a sticker on the back or bottom of the device. It can also be found in the web interface (section System → Device Information) or in the Beeline Dom mobile application.

📱 Is it possible to access the router settings from a phone?

Yes, but it's best to use a laptop or PC. Smartphones may have issues displaying the interface (especially on older router models). If you're logging in from a phone:

  1. Connect to your router's Wi-Fi.
  2. Open your browser (Chrome or Safari).
  3. Enter the IP address in the address bar.

Avoid browsers with aggressive optimization (such as Opera Mini).

🔄 What should I do if my router doesn't provide internet after a reset?

After the reset, you need to reconfigure your connection to your provider:

  1. Log in to the web interface (use the standard login/password).
  2. Go to the section WAN or Internet.
  3. Select connection type PPPoE (for Beeline).
  4. Enter the login and password from your contract with your provider.
  5. Save the settings and reboot the router.

If you don't know your connection details, check them in your Beeline account or by calling support.

🛡️ How to block other people's devices on your Wi-Fi network?

In the router control panel, find the section Wireless → MAC Filtering (or DHCP → Client List). There you'll see a list of connected devices. To block:

  1. Copy MAC address someone else's device.
  2. Add him to the blacklist (Blacklist).
  3. Save the settings.

It is also recommended to enable WPA3- encryption in Wi-Fi security settings.

📡 Why does my router reboot frequently after setup?

Frequent reboots can be caused by:

  • The device is overheating (check the ventilation holes).
  • Unstable power supply (use a surge protector).
  • Damaged firmware (update software via web interface).
  • IP address conflict (set up a static IP for the router).

If the problem persists, please contact Beeline support for hardware diagnostics.
